statchute.xyz
18 Subscribers
17665 Views
122 Videos
Spirituality & Faith
#13891
Subscriber Rank
#13773
View Rank
#7189
Video Rank
-100%
Subs in the last 30 days
606 +0.5%
Views in the last 30 days
0%
Videos in the last 30 days